Are you ready to join Clario as a Respiratory OverRead Clinical Specialist (f/m/x) in full time (40h/week)? At Clario, we have supported our customers in achieving their goals at more than 80,000 sites worldwide. We understand that generating meaningful, valid, high-quality data in respiratory studies is notoriously difficult. That’s why we leverage decades of experience and the latest tools and technologies to reduce data variability, identify outliers, and produce exceptional data – study after study.

What You’ll Be Doing
- Perform analysis on pulmonary function data
- Resolve questions from sponsors, investigator sites, monitors, and project managers about data quality
- Ensure that all Respiratory OverRead clinical trials meet their contracted turnaround time
- Provide reports to the Director of Respiratory OverRead about the status of the Respiratory OverRead program as requested and periodically
What We Look For
- Minimum of a Bachelor’s degree from a technical college or university with a major in respiratory, physiology, life sciences, or related experience with a minimum of 2 years of college in biological sciences from an accredited university and relevant work experience
- Preferred National Board of Respiratory Care (NBRC) certifications: Certified Pulmonary Function Technologist (CPFT), Registered Pulmonary Function Technologist (RPFT), Certified Respiratory Therapist (CRT), Registered Respiratory Therapist (RRT), or equivalent certifications
- 2 or more years of experience in pulmonary function testing or related experience
- Must be an analytical thinker, able to collect and analyze information to develop solutions for complex and simple problems
- Good customer support skills
- Ability to communicate effectively in writing and verbally
- Good interpersonal skills
- Proficient in Microsoft Office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and G Suite applications
- Ability to work independently within a dynamic environment

Clario is a leading provider of endpoint data solutions to the clinical trials industry, generating high-quality clinical evidence for life sciences companies. We offer comprehensive evidence generation solutions that combine medical imaging, eCOA, precision motion, cardiac solutions and respiratory endpoints.
For more than 50 years, Clario has delivered deep scientific expertise and broad endpoint technologies to help transform lives around the world. Our endpoint data solutions have supported over 30,000 clinical trials in more than 100 countries. Our global team of science, technology, and operational experts have supported over 70% of all FDA drug approvals since 2015.
